A new round of tickets for the highly sought-after Obama Presidential Center museum went live Wednesday morning at 10 a.m. CT, with long queues immediately forming.
The center told Block Club Chicago it expects “high demand for tickets,” with those trying to purchase tickets likely experiencing a wait.
How many Obama Presidential Center tickets are on sale? Which dates?
The center said on its site Wednesday that 15,000 museum tickets for dates between Jan. 4-31, 2027, as well as 6,900 tickets for October 2026, will be available.
The center recommends having several dates and times in mind going into the queue. Individuals can purchase up to nine tickets each.
Are tickets still available for Obama Presidential Center?
As of 10:15 a.m. CT Wednesday morning, the estimated wait time for tickets stood at “more than an hour.”
The site includes a disclaimer that “If your wait time is longer than one hour, it is unlikely tickets will be available when it is your turn.”
When will Obama Center tickets go on sale again?
The museum updates ticket availability on the second Wednesday of every month at 10 a.m. CT.
Fans can sign up for notifications to get reminded when the next batch goes on sale.
Where in Chicago is Obama Presidential Center?
The center is located at 6001 S. Stony Island Ave. in the southern Chicago neighborhood of Woodlawn.
